Patch to enable fontconfig hinting and replacements

This patch is an attempt to use fontconfig (specifically, what is defined in
/etc/fonts and/or ~/.fonts.conf) to handle the hinting and replacements of
fonts.  This should allow the end user to make WINE programs appear more
integrated with the rest of the desktop, if they choose to enable it.  

The general idea is to inject the fontconfig data at the step in
WineEngCreateFontInstance prior to opening the font face.  This allows the
GdiFont to be satisfied that it is getting the face it requested, and also
rendering it the way fontconfig says to.  This method still allows for the font
replacement mechanism in WINE to work, as this works beneath it, not trying to
compete with it.  The fontconfig data and load flags for freetype are stored in
tagGdiFont, and the load flags are then used in the rendering step.  Also,
Fontconfig initialization was brought out into a separate function, as
fontconfig is now used in more than one place.

As I figured people may not want this on by default, it can be enabled by
setting this DWORD registry key:
HKCU\Software\Wine\Fonts\UseFontconfig = 1

If fontconfig is not available, the code is #ifdef'ed out, and if turned off in
the registry (default), WINE uses its normal behavior.
